Interface ITreeProvider<T>

Type Parameters:
T - the node type
All Superinterfaces:
IClusterable, IDetachable, Serializable
All Known Subinterfaces:
ISortableTreeProvider<T,S>
All Known Implementing Classes:
SortableTreeProvider, TreeModelProvider

public interface ITreeProvider<T> extends IDetachable
Provider of a tree. You can use the IDetachable.detach() method for cleaning up your ITreeProvider instance.

  • Method Details

    • getRoots

      Iterator<? extends T> getRoots()
      Get the roots of the tree.
      Returns:
      roots
    • hasChildren

      boolean hasChildren(T node)
      Does the given object have children - note that this method may return true even if getChildren(Object) returns an empty iterator.
      Parameters:
      node - the node to check for children
      Returns:
      true if node has children
    • getChildren

      Iterator<? extends T> getChildren(T node)
      Get the children of the given node.
      Parameters:
      node - node to get children for
      Returns:
      children of node
    • model

      IModel<T> model(T object)
      Callback used by the consumer of this tree provider to wrap objects retrieved from getRoots() or getChildren(Object) with a model (usually a detachable one).

      Important note: The model must implement Object.equals(Object) and Object.hashCode() !

      Parameters:
      object - the object that needs to be wrapped
      Returns:
      the model representation of the object
